Tailor made trolley solutions
October 1st 2007

With 1.2 million different configurations available,Vileda Professional's claim that its Origo Line is no ordinary trolley stands up to scrutiny

If a standard trolley is what you're after, it's in the Origo range, but if what you really want is a trolley that you can customise to meet the exact requirements of your operatives and clients,Vileda Professional says the Origo Line has got that too.

"Whether it's healthcare, office or general cleaning, a trolley is an essential part of an efficient cleaning regime," says Vileda's marketing manager Steve Barber.

"Origo offers tailor-made solutions for every cleaning situation.

Developed by an award winning design team, the Origo Line is easy to use and uses ergonomics to create a state-of-the-art cleaning tool." The Origo 100 is the entry level model with a plastic base, fixed configuration and no-tools needed assembly. Suitable for general cleaning, it includes the Ultraspeed wet flat mopping system.

Also with a plastic base, the Origo 300 series is the configurable alternative to the 100.The HX version is suitable for pre-prepared office cleaning with Swep and Swep duo while the FX is designed for general cleaning and wet flat mopping with the Ultraspeed system.

The Origo 500 is based on a metal frame construction using antirust, zinc-plated varnished steel. Suitable for pre-prepared hospital cleaning it has almost endless configurations available.Trays can be moved, buckets added, and extensions bolted-on. If you haven't found what you are looking for with these base models, then you can configure your own using the Origo configurator at www.origo.vileda.com.

"All you do is choose your base model and then have fun mixing and matching components, equipping and extending your Origo trolley to your specific requirements which can then be saved prior to order or retro-fitted when your requirements change," added Steve."It's a simple matter of dragging and dropping and mixing and matching until you are happy with your selection." As well as being modular, Origo is tailor-made to carry the entire Vileda range of cleaning products and incorporates colour coded clips which attach to all the system's accessories.
